Ferrari is developing a successor to the current 575 Maranello, which has been on the market since 1996. Various prototypes are currently being tested in and around Ferrari's hometown, as can be seen on the photos.
The new vehicle, code-named F139 and designed by Pininfarina, sits on the shortened platform of the Ferrari 612 Scaglietti, which makes the next 575 M considerably bigger, providing a roomier passenger cabin and a larger luggage compartment.
The engine, based on the 5.75-liter V-12 from the Scaglietti, has been bored out to 6.0 liters and will deliver between 580 and 600 hp.
According to rumours, the name of the new model could be 600 Maranello or Imola, and it is expected to be released in 2006.
